TransparentUpgradeableProxy
Verified contract
Proxy
Active on
Ethereum with 1,038 txns
Unified storage
Map
Table
Raw
Constants and immutables
2
Slot
XX
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
-
variable spans 48 additional slots
0x58f1…bda4
0x4832…7349
0x38e4…7e1d
9 additional
variables
Balances ($0.00)
No balances found for "TransparentUpgradeableProxy"
Transactions
Txn hash | Method | Block | Age | From | To | Value (ETH) | Fee (ETH) |
---|---|---|---|---|---|---|---|
| 15916677 | 2 years ago | | | 0 | 0.00083492337 | |
| 15820093 | 2 years ago | | | 0 | 0.0017152236 | |
| 15804433 | 2 years ago | | | 0 | 0.0017941256 | |
| 15804170 | 2 years ago | | | 0 | 0.0015251291 | |
| 15804158 | 2 years ago | | | 0 | 0.0015029409 | |
| 15797829 | 2 years ago | | | 0 | 0.0024614964 | |
| 15797790 | 2 years ago | | | 0 | 0.0023428527 | |
| 15797750 | 2 years ago | | | 0 | 0.0022112152 | |
| 15797523 | 2 years ago | | | 0 | 0.0022040465 | |
| 15797009 | 2 years ago | | | 0 | 0.0026471629 |
ABI
ABI objects
Getter at block 21210080
EVAltReceiver() view returns (address)
0x71455dce4edfacab42e72b59b324c964fa2b910c
EVNFT() view returns (address)
0x58f132fc962c99e46959b78f0721dcdb2b64bda4
EVSacrificeReceiver() view returns (address)
0x04f673ad6891c20678c5cfcd7e4f2025b3359421
EVStaking() view returns (address)
0x38e4bcb84c5b5fa72fd8c2c1a6a8da7b8c017e1d
EVWL() view returns (address)
0x483273f689dcf43e72068915a61ceea66a2c7349
altp() view returns (uint256)
59000000000000000
authorizedSigner() view returns (address)
0x1ff320ea993174db994a37d0f71ff6549ec7a0d2
collectionsMerkleRoot() view returns (bytes32)
0xe7901b6c798e8be9d88c6d4df23f81477cdf2499d78c0c74827da4ef58a0da80
evMaxSupply() view returns (uint256)
1254
getRemainingVikings() view returns (uint256)
0
goldPrice() view returns (uint256)
1000000000000000000000
goldToken() view returns (address)
0x62f5c63fdb767ad1e891a872f39e3852c33132ad
owner() view returns (address)
0x0ac6532b457044ada87c1badb7a60dd20f830feb
preMintEnd() view returns (uint256)
1663873201
preMintMerkleRoot() view returns (bytes32)
0x1c75407c843d86642e3b559cb84e86c611212e760398c4a9914e78af1629f699
preMintStart() view returns (uint256)
1663873200
privateEnd() view returns (uint256)
1979233200
privateStart() view returns (uint256)
1663858680
publicEnd() view returns (uint256)
1979233200
publicStart() view returns (uint256)
1663887480
walletLimit() view returns (uint256)
5
yielder() view returns (address)
0x5e14ef27a701de27f9d0303011d02073ed562b47
Read-only
authorizedTester(address) view returns (bool)
ringAuctionDeadline(uint256) view returns (uint256)
ringBids(uint256, address) view returns (uint256)
ringHighestBid(uint256) view returns (uint256)
ringHighestBidder(uint256) view returns (address)
signatureTester(address user, address collection, uint256 assetId, uint256 expiration, bytes signature) view returns (bool)
walletCount(address) view returns (uint256)
State-modifying
Events admin() returns (address)
changeAdmin(address newAdmin)
implementation() returns (address)
upgradeTo(address newImplementation)
upgradeToAndCall(address newImplementation, bytes data) payable
addRingAuction(uint256 id, uint256 deadline)
claimBackAuctionGold(uint256 auctionId)
enterAuction(uint256 auctionId, uint256 bid)
initialize(address ev, address evwl, address receiver, address altReceiver)
renounceOwnership()
sacrificeAltNew() payable
sacrificeGold()
sacrificeNew(address collection, uint256 assetId, uint256 expiration, bytes signature, bool stake, bool isERC1155)
setAltP(uint256 _altP)
setAuthorizedSigner(address signer)
setAuthorizedTesters(address[] testers, bool[] states)
setCollectionsMerkleRoot(bytes32 merkleRoot)
setEV(address ev)
setEVAltReceiver(address receiver)
setEVMaxSupply(uint256 maxSupply)
setEVSacrificeReceiver(address receiver)
setEVStaking(address staking)
setEVWL(address evwl)
setGoldPrice(uint256 price)
setGoldToken(address _token)
setLimit(uint256 limit)
setPreMintDates(uint256 start, uint256 end)
setPreMintMerkleRoot(bytes32 merkleRoot)
setPrivateDates(uint256 start, uint256 end)
setPublicDates(uint256 start, uint256 end)
setYielder(address yldr)
transferOwnership(address newOwner)
vikingAirdrops(address[] receivers, uint256[] amount)
whitelistMint(uint256 tokenId, bool stake)
withdraw()
AdminChanged(address previousAdmin, address newAdmin)
Upgraded(address indexed implementation)
Bribe(address user, uint256 mintedVikingId)
BribeGold(address user, uint256 mintedVikingId)
EnterAuction(address indexed user, uint256 auctionId, uint256 bid)
Initialized(uint8 version)
OwnershipTransferred(address indexed previousOwner, address indexed newOwner)
RedeemAuction(address indexed user, uint256 auctionId, uint256 totalBid)
Sacrifice(address user, address sacrificedCollection, uint256 sacrificedTokenId, uint256 mintedVikingId, bool isStaked)
constructor(address initialLogic, address initialAdmin, bytes _data)
fallback()
receive()
receive()
This contract contains no error objects.